A useful website should explain itself twice
People need pages they can scan, explore, and trust. AI agents need the same ideas in a representation they can retrieve without reconstructing a product from navigation, animation, and visual layout. Grain now serves both from the same public site.
Every canonical Grain page has a concise Markdown mirror under the agent index. The visual page remains the source people share and search engines index; the mirror gives an agent the title, summary, important concepts, and canonical destination in clean text.
Three ways for an agent to start
An agent can begin with llms.txt for a compact map, open the full agent index to choose a relevant page, or read llms-full.txt when one request needs the complete public corpus. Page-level mirrors cover the product, documentation, solutions, comparisons, pricing, security, and every blog story.

Cleaner discovery without duplicate pages
Agent-readable does not mean duplicating the public website in search. The Markdown routes are marked for retrieval but not indexing, and every mirror points back to its canonical HTML page. Alternate entry points now consolidate on the main Grain homepage instead of competing with it.
The sitemap has also been rebuilt around the pages Grain actually wants discovered. It includes the full product, solutions, comparison, legal, and blog surface while leaving machine-only mirrors out of the search index.
Better context wherever a page appears
Each canonical page now has a specific title, description, canonical URL, and social preview. Structured data describes Grain as an organization, website, software product, article publisher, and page collection where each type applies. The blog also publishes a first-class RSS feed.
These details are small in the interface and important everywhere else. Search engines get a consistent description. Social links arrive with a useful preview. Readers and agents can subscribe to new stories without checking the site manually.

One update changes the whole discovery layer
A new Grain story now joins the blog, RSS feed, sitemap, structured article data, agent index, and full Markdown corpus from one content record. That keeps the human and machine versions aligned as the product changes.
